Description of Services

  • Responsible for planning, developing and implementing social, recreational and special events for all members of the community
  • Seeks to share activities with members of the city of Thunder Bay and surrounding communities
  • Recreational activities and facilities include:
    • Arena and gymnasium
    • Baseball diamond
    • Bingo hall
    • Chippewa Park
    • Driving range
    • Fitness facility
    • Mount McKay scenic lookout and trails
    • Outdoor paintball facility
